Jak wybrać najlepszy serwer multimediów strumieniowych?

Serwer to połączenie sprzętu i oprogramowania zaprojektowane w celu zaspokojenia określonych potrzeb, na ogół wielu klientów. Serwer multimediów strumieniowych przesyła strumieniowo wideo przechowywane na serwerze do klientów, którzy o to proszą, gdy jest wywoływany przez serwer WWW. Najlepszym serwerem multimediów strumieniowych do Twoich celów będzie taki, który najlepiej zaspokoi Twoje potrzeby w zakresie kosztów, obsługiwanych systemów operacyjnych, obsługiwanych formatów kontenerów, obsługiwanych protokołów i innych kluczowych funkcji. Ponadto ważne jest, aby zdecydować, czy prowadzić własny serwer, czy kupić hostingowy plan transmisji strumieniowej.

Tak działa proces przesyłania strumieniowego multimediów. Odwiedzający stronę internetową klika plik wideo, który chce wyświetlić. Serwer WWW przekazuje wiadomość do serwera multimediów strumieniowych. Wreszcie serwer multimediów strumieniowych przesyła plik bezpośrednio do gościa, a oprogramowanie na komputerze gościa odtwarza plik. Zasadniczo, jeśli użytkownik nie ma na swoim komputerze odpowiedniego oprogramowania lub najnowszej wersji oprogramowania, zostanie podana pomocna wiadomość, zwykle z linkiem do bezpłatnego pobrania. Serwer multimediów strumieniowych musi być w stanie obsłużyć ruch i przepustowość wymagane przez streaming.

Serwery multimediów strumieniowych z licencją GPL prawdopodobnie będą bezpłatne. Serwery z prawami własności są bardziej narażone na związane z tym koszty, przynajmniej do użytku komercyjnego. Nie wszystkie serwery multimediów strumieniowych działają z systemami Mac OS X, Linux lub innymi systemami operacyjnymi Unix, dlatego ważne jest, aby dokonać wyboru, który będzie działał. Serwery zastrzeżone mogą także obsługiwać mniej formatów niż serwery open source. Na przykład serwer strumieniowy Apple® QuickTime® obsługuje mniej formatów niż Helix® Universal Server, który obsługuje platformy Microsoft®, takie jak Windows Media®, a także QuickTime® firmy Apple i MPEG-4.

Protokół używany przez serwer multimediów strumieniowych do dostarczania danych jest kluczem do tego, jak serwer będzie działał pod dużym obciążeniem i jakie rodzaje rzeczy mogą pójść nie tak z usługą. Niektóre z często używanych protokołów to HTTP (Hypertext Transfer Protocol), który może być najczęściej używany, TCP (Transmission Control Protocol), RTP (Real-time Transfer Protocol), RTSP (Real-Time Streaming Protocol) i RTMP ( Real-Time Messaging Protocol), z których ostatni jest używany przez Adobe® Flash® Media Server. Połączenie tych, które najlepiej pasują do mediów, które zamierzasz obsługiwać, w połączeniu z wyborem samodzielnego udostępniania materiału lub zakupu hostowanego planu transmisji strumieniowej, zapewni ci najlepszy serwer multimediów strumieniowych do twoich celów.

INNE JĘZYKI

Czy ten artykuł był pomocny? Dzięki za opinie Dzięki za opinie

Jak możemy pomóc? Jak możemy pomóc?